1. Set Clear and Achievable Goals

Success starts with clarity. Without clear goals, your study efforts can become unfocused and ineffective.

Instead of vague targets like “I want good marks,” define specific goals such as:

  • Scoring above 85% in exams
  • Completing 2 chapters daily
  • Practicing 20 math problems each day

Breaking larger goals into smaller tasks helps you stay motivated and track your progress easily.

2. Create an Effective Study Plan

A well-structured study plan is essential for success. It helps you manage time efficiently and ensures that every subject gets proper attention.

Tips for making a study plan:

  • Allocate more time to difficult subjects
  • Study when your mind is fresh (morning or early evening)
  • Include short breaks to avoid burnout
  • Reserve time for revision

Consistency is more important than studying for long hours occasionally.

3. Focus on Conceptual Learning

Rote memorization is outdated. Modern exams focus on understanding and application.

To improve conceptual learning:

  • Ask questions like “why” and “how”
  • Connect concepts with real-life examples
  • Use diagrams and visual aids

When you understand a topic deeply, it becomes easier to recall during exams

4. Use Active Study Techniques

Passive reading is not enough for long-term retention. Active learning keeps your brain engaged.

Effective techniques include:

  • Writing notes in your own words
  • Teaching concepts to someone else
  • Using flashcards for quick revision
  • Solving quizzes and practice tests

Active learning improves memory and helps you retain information longer.

5. Practice Regularly

Practice is one of the most important factors in achieving good marks.

Make it a habit to

  • Solve past papers
  • Attempt mock exams
  • Practice writing structured answers

This not only improves accuracy but also boosts your confidence and time management during exams.

6. Eliminate Distractions

In today’s digital world, distractions like social media and mobile phones can ruin your focus.

To stay productive:

  • Keep your phone away while studying
  • Use apps to block distractions
  • Study in a quiet and organized environment

You can also follow the Pomodoro Technique:

Study for 25 minutes, then take a 5-minute break.

7. Take Care of Your Health

Your physical and mental health directly affect your academic performance.

Important habits:

  • Sleep 7–8 hours daily
  • Eat nutritious food
  • Stay hydrated
  • Exercise regularly

A healthy body leads to a sharp and focused mind.

8. Revise Consistently

Revision is the key to long-term retention. Without revision, you may forget what you studied.

Smart revision tips:

  • Revise weekly and monthly
  • Highlight important points
  • Create short notes for quick review
  • Focus more on weak areas

10. Learn from Your Mistakes

Mistakes are not failures—they are opportunities to improve.

After every test:

  • Analyze your errors
  • Understand where you went wrong
  • Work on weak areas

This habit helps you avoid repeating the same mistakes and steadily improves your results.
